为什么我的linuxmint中安装了两个pip?

时间:2019-02-27 19:35:26

标签: linux pip

2 pip are installed one is v 9 and other is v 19

如何将pip更新到最新版本19? 由于此版本冲突,我无法下载某些软件包。 而且我只希望安装一个最新的pip版本,并将其用于所有软件包中。

1 个答案:

答案 0 :(得分:0)

您安装了python和pip的两个不同版本。这很常见。

/usr/local/lib/python2.7/dist-packages/pip很有可能由操作系统安装,并允许您sudo pip install Python 2.7软件包。

/home/manish/.local/lib/python3.5/site-packages/pip位于主文件夹中,这意味着您不必将用户特权提升为pip install软件包。这是针对Python 3.5的。

管理Python版本和依赖项可能会造成极大的混乱,特别是如果您只是想跟着教程学习。

我推荐的最好的工具是pyenv。它使您可以在主文件夹中安装任何版本的python,并允许您通过创建.python-version文件在每个项目(文件夹)的基础上进行切换。 pyenv